Books about Baacha Khan available, so far

English: 



  1. Nonviolent Soldier of Islam. Badshah Khan, A Man to Match His Mountains.

    Badshah Khan & Mahatma Ghandhi Allies in Revolution of Human Spirit
    Pioneers in a Culture of Peace. By Eknath Easwaran. Nilgiri Press
     California, USA 1999


  2.  Rajmohan Gandhi (2004). Ghaffar Khan: non-violent Badshah of the Pakhtuns. Viking, New Delhi. ISBN 0-670-05765-7


    • Mukulika Banerjee (2000). Pathan Unarmed: Opposition & Memory in the North West Frontier. School of American Research Press. ISBN 0-933452-68-3






    • Khan Abdul Ghaffar Khan: A True Servant of Humanity by Girdhari Lal Puri pp 188-190.






    • Pilgrimage for Peace: Gandhi and Frontier Gandhi Among N.W.F. Pathans, Pyarelal, Ahmedabad, Navajivan Publishing House, 1950.






    • Khan Abdul Ghaffar Khan: A Centennial Tribute by Nehru Memorial Museum and Library and Abdul Ghaffar Khan(1995)






    • Khudai khidmatgar and national movement: Momentous speeches of Badshah Khan by Abdul Ghaffar Khan 1992
